RESORTS:

CERRO CATEDRAL - BARILOCHE:
This mountain is the most advanced ski center in Argentina and South America. It offers the best services in ski for beginners, intermediates or skilful sportsman, ski rentals and trails for all levels, besides the many alternatives in lodging and entertainment for its proximity to San Carlos de Bariloche.
LAS LENIAS - MENDOZA:
This ski center is the closest one to Buenos Aires and its located 500 kilometers away from Mendoza and 26 kilometers of distance to chilean frontier. Las Leñas is in the middle of Los Andes Mountain, its Base is more than 2000 mts from the level of the sea and the summit is over 3000 mts, allowing a long season from june to September.
CHAPELCO - SAN MARTIN DE LOS ANDES:
Located in San Martin de los Andes, in the Neuquen province inside of argentinean Patagonia, is Chapelco Mountain, counting with a height of more than 1900 meters, which makes of it one the most attractives ski centers in the country. Chapelco Mountain counts with ski runs for every level and allows practicing the winter.

VALLE NEVADO - SANTIAGO DE CHILE:
Very close to Santiago de Chile, in the heart of the Andes, is the largest winter resort in the Southern hemisphere and, probably, the most modern in Patagonia. Its name is a synonym for ski: Valle Nevado is located 3,025 meters over sea level, which ensures snow every winter to practice our favorite sport
